What is this growth? It’s been there a while — it used to look like a boil, now the top seems to have lost blood flow but hasn’t fallen off, and the base has broken open. Does it need to be removed?

From the photo, the dog likely has a polyp on its neck. If it shows no other abnormality it can be left alone, but if it bleeds or ulcerates it is prone to infection and should be removed at a vet. After removal, follow the vet's post-op care to prevent infection, and a biopsy may be needed to check the cells.

My dog fell from a height; the right hind leg won’t touch the ground, it keeps lying down, eats and drinks, breathes a bit fast, no stool or urine. Bone fractures are ruled out; the right hind leg root/butt area hurts when pressed firmly but not lightly, and lifting the leg hurts, like pain in the leg pit. What is it, is it serious?

A fall can injure the pelvis and hip (sciatic, pubic, iliac bones) or nerves, affecting defecation and possibly causing hind-limb paralysis. A firm pelvic press causing pain fits this. Get a DR X-ray; fix if fractured, or use anti-inflammatory and NSAID painkillers conservatively.

Why is my dog’s creatine kinase (CK) high?

CK rises when muscle is damaged; it is found in muscle, heart, brain, liver, and bone. Injury releases CK, which then falls; intense exercise also releases large amounts and spikes the level.

When do Teddy dogs lose their baby teeth?

A Teddy's deciduous teeth emerge 2-4 weeks after birth and are fully grown by about 8 weeks. As the dog grows, generally around 3-4 months of age the baby teeth begin to fall out and permanent teeth come in. The teething duration varies by breed and constitution, but in most cases they finish changing teeth by 6-8 months. During teething, the owner should pay attention to the dog's diet and oral health, and can appropriately supplement calcium to avoid a 'double row of teeth' caused by calcium deficiency.

What is a ‘week dog’?

A 'week dog' refers to a dog that looks energetic at the time of purchase but becomes ill or dies about a week later. Most of these dogs are bought from roadside vendors or unlicensed kennels. Most 'week dogs' have infectious diseases such as distemper, and a few carry zoonotic bacteria - not only do they themselves get sick and die, they can also transmit infection to the owner and cause the owner to become ill. Therefore, if you want to buy a pet dog, it is best to purchase from a reputable pet store.

My dog fell from about one meter high. It was fine the night it happened, but the next morning its hind legs couldn’t support it.

According to the frontal X-ray, the dog has a displaced fracture of the femur along with abnormal hip development. In hip dysplasia the hip socket is too shallow and the femoral head does not sit properly in the acetabulum; this is usually congenital and may not cause problems at first. The fall triggered a femoral fracture that revealed the underlying hip issue, leading to lameness and pain, and muscle atrophy can develop over time.
